The Chiltern Gundog Society held a novice a.v. spaniel trial at Culham Estate, Oxfordshire.
The trial was very different in that it was held on marshland and water meadows 100yds from the River Thames on a beautiful crisp winter’s day.
Headkeeper Andy Read had prepared the ground and it was well stocked with pheasant. The estate guns shot well and there were plenty of birds brought down for the dogs to retrieve.
Judges John Crawford and Lyn Randall gave all the dogs plenty of time to show their prowess but with so many birds in the marshland, many dogs put themselves out.

RESULTS
1 Eric Smith with ESS d. Countryways Falcon
2 John Keegan with ESS d. Shot to Fame in Geordieland
3(& Guns’ Choice) R. Preest with ESS b. Spinnchetti Dawn
4 Steve Blackman with ESS d. Deepfleet Harry Lime at Bonniemore
CoM John Sexton with ESS d. Testway Tornado
